Peggy Kirkpatrick is an accomplished legal professional with extensive experience in legal writing and advocacy. Since August 2010, Peggy has served as the Associate Director of Legal Writing and as a Legal Writing Instructor at Mitchell Hamline School of Law. Prior to this role, Peggy was a Law Clerk for Judge Matthew Johnson at the Minnesota Court of Appeals from January 2008 to August 2009, and an Associate Attorney and Staff Attorney at Leonard, Street and Deinard from December 2000 to December 2007. Peggy earned a Juris Doctor degree, Magna Cum Laude, from the University of Minnesota Law School (1997-2000), a Master of Arts in American History from Northwestern University (1994-1995), and a Bachelor of Arts in History, Summa Cum Laude, from Middlebury College (1990-1994).
